//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Dragon’s Fire Trial Enjoy Totally free Position Online game - Acacia
loader

Ok, that it’s maybe not a separate sense, however it does make us feel like you rating two unique have rather than you to definitely. During the human history, of numerous countries has passed down stories out of mythical scaled giants you to definitely can be inhale fire and you will wield strong miracle. If it’s the new lion-confronted dance creatures in the east and/or slithering wyrms away from medieval lore, dragons hold an alternative put in quite a few hearts. He is normal have in every sort of mass media, as well as online slots games. For your enjoyment, you will find scoured the net to create your some of the finest ports presenting such monsters out of myth and dream.

That it vintage position are suited for all kinds of professionals, and you may enjoy 50 Dragons on line 100 percent free to the the website now. Yet not, prior to starting so you can spin the new reels, make sure to comprehend all of our opinion. With respect to the quantity of professionals looking for they, Dragon Egg isn’t a very popular position.

Dragon Eggs Slot is established because of the Tom Horn which can be really preferred slot right now. You’ll find which position in lots of online casinos around the community. You could gamble Dragon Egg slot at no cost on the internet enjoyment during the Sloto.ge. Tom Horn ports fans generally speaking will certainly such as this position, because it’s the style of enjoy that is feature from the corporation so there are numerous factors becoming came across. Searching for a safe and you will reliable real cash gambling establishment to try out in the? Listed below are some our list of the best a real income casinos on the internet right here.

Real cash Slots

Dragon Egg is actually a great 5×3 grid casino slot games online game out of Tom Horn Gambling. The overall game features nine variable paylines that run across its four reels and about three rows. The new slot identity gets an obvious understanding of exactly what people is always to expect in terms of theme, patterns, and you can symbols within the gameplay. On the spin twenty-five, a huge secure out of twenty-five.90 falls, however, yet, it has been far more calmness than just in the fairly crappy profile. Multiple gains house, and many much more Dragon Fire signs alter the game, yet , wear’t profits enough once my personal 50 revolves so you can cash out.

Large RTP Tom Horn Playing ports

hoyle casino games online free

Yet not, the fresh bluish dragon is worth five hundred, as the gold and you may red dragons is for each valued from the 750. These represent the higher RTP (Come back to user) commission harbors I discovered from Tom Horn Betting. Record 777spinslots.com proceed this site try establish away from large RTP so you can lowest RTP fee. If you need something else and you can refreshing immediately after ports, Spinball may be worth trying out. Spinball provides stressful action in the a real 80’s Pinball arcade hall build.

The new game play have common incentive provides such Wilds, Scatters, Free Spins, and you may a play feature which allows professionals to increase its profits. Additionally, the design, graphics, and you can soundtrack of your position give a good enchanting mood. The newest spread out icons, in the amounts of step three, cuatro, or 5, searching on the reels often result in the newest Dragon Egg Extra Ability.

Visit ReallyBestSlots for lots more mythological-styled online game for example Mazu and you will 777, and attempt your own luck at no cost or real money at the required casinos on the internet. What set the fresh Fire Egg on the web position aside as one of the fresh biggest online slots is actually its game play elements. The fresh insane symbol, illustrated by a good fearsome dragon’s eyes, can also be substitute for some other icon to create successful combos.

Find All the Crypto Gambling establishment Guides

The brand new slot online game are appearing more frequently than you think. Usually i’ve built up relationships on the websites’s best slot online game designers, so if another games is going to drop they’s probably i’ll discover they earliest. If you wear’t desire to be at the rear of the fresh contour, stick with us.

best online casino reddit

One of many half a dozen dragons there will be, the new black colored nuts dragon is the sneakiest, never ever sharing himself until he’s the top of hand. Flames walk inside the wake, therefore it is possible to see the telltale plumes from cigarette smoking just before finding attention out of your. These types of Bitcoin gambling enterprises have to offer Tom Horn Playing harbors within their alternatives. After each win, for many who refuge’t reached your own gamble limitation, you are given the brand new Gamble button.

SlotoZilla is a separate site which have totally free online casino games and reviews. All the details on the site provides a purpose only to entertain and you will teach folks. It’s the newest group’ responsibility to check on your local laws and regulations just before playing on the web. Play responsibly and always read small print. Full, I experienced a good gambling experience to the reels associated with the video game.

Position Features

Little unique, but doesn’t research otherwise sound horrible possibly. The brand new straight games desk but not doesn’t work inside computer systems because the enjoy city is pretty quick. Next photo you can observe the newest struck portion and you will the brand new multipliers away from bet from the for each and every strike. Perhaps you have realized a knowledgeable city is found on the center kept the spot where the about three bullet bouncers offers 0.3x bet for each and every struck. You can also features totally free “spins” from Spinball if you hit the eco-friendly slots in the better right part. If you get 3 Guide icons that will lead to 10 Free Spins.

The new Celebrity Dragon video slot will come fitted which have HTML 5 technical in order that it’s a mobile-friendly slot. Therefore, it functions effortlessly to the all of the Android and ios-pushed cellphones. Around three spread icons cause 15 totally free spins, which you’ll retrigger. While the scary while the dragons could be, he could be bearers of great fortune in several Far east countries.

Play Dragon Eggs 100percent free Today Inside Demonstration Function

no deposit bonus blog 1

The fresh multiplier increases every time the player achieves a consecutive win. The fresh icon payouts of the free slots 50 Dragons is listed lower than. Keep in mind that these are repaired (static) philosophy, and do not changes considering your wager count. Gold Dragon, Tiger and you will Unicorn buy a combination of simply a couple icons. People is also earn ten (for 2 Gold Dragons) and you will cuatro (for 2 Tigers or 2 Unicorns). The brand new picture and you can tunes don’t give something special on the games, but they are on the a great peak.